Clear before arrival
Pet size, coat condition, handling needs, service scope, parking and route timing all shape the visit. We confirm those details with you before booking.
Share coat, temperament, sensitivities and recent grooming history in one place.
Likely changes are discussed before the visit and any new change needs owner approval.
The groom may be adapted or stopped if continuing is not suitable for the pet.
